Lithium Ion Battery Power Tools

Lithium ion battery-powered tools provide the kind of power and utility demanded by today's homeowner, while being quite useful for the professional contractor, too. Purchasing and caring for lithium ion power tools is not entirely different from caring for corded power tools, but it can help to keep a few things in mind before shopping for, caring for, using and discarding lithium ion batteries and cordless obrital sander tools.

Purchasing Lithium Ion Power Tools

Nearly all cord-operated tools, from jig saws to drills and cut-off wheels, also have a lithium ion battery-operated counterpart. Oftentimes, lithium ion power tools are sold as either 12-volt or 18-volt varieties, with the 12-volt tools being less expensive and less powerful. Tools rated at 12 volts are generally considered the right size for light duty, occasional jobs around the house; 18-volt lithium ion power tools are more expensive, more powerful and more common with professional contractors because they tend to see heavy daily service. When purchasing these tools, consider buying an additional battery so that one can remain charging while you use the other.

Using Lithium Ion Power Tools

Lithium ion power tools don't work any differently from corded hand power tools except that they will discharge, sometimes within 20 to 30 minutes of continued use. If you need to use the tool throughout the day, you may want to keep a small bank of lithium ion batteries at your disposal to replace discharged batteries.

 

Caring for Lithium Ion Power Tools

Lithium ion power tools require the same care as ordinary hand tools, with the exception of keeping the lithium ion battery pack charged. When you're through with the tool, remove the battery if it is fully discharged and recharge it. If it is not fully discharged, keep the battery with the tool until you can no longer use it. Like your cellular phone, lithium ion batteries can grow a "battery memory" and take on only a half-charge or less if you continually recharge half-discharged batteries. For the tool itself, apply a few drops of household oil to the moving parts regularly to keep them in good working condition. Keep them in a dry environment to prevent corrosion to the battery terminals and the tool's metal parts.

Disposing of Lithium Ion Batteries Safely

Lithium ion battery packs should never be disposed of in ordinary trash receptacles. When the lithium ion battery will no longer hold a charge, recycle the battery at the store where you purchased the power tool or at another battery recycling station. Many stores offer battery recycling, particularly hardware and electronics stores that sell lithium ion batteries.

Many industrial concerns have workshops of their own

Many industrial concerns have workshops of their own. For the repair of worn shafts, the lathe machine is excellent. Keyway slots can be machined by using a milling machine, while a shaping machine can do machining of large flat areas. A drilling machine does drilling of holes.

A skilled Maintenance Engineer should know how to use all these machines in order to make his own repairs in a safe manner. Very often he has to supervise machinists. The information below should be useful for that purpose.

Lathe Machine

The lathe machine uses a single-point-cutting tool for Cordless Impact Wrenches Suppliers a variety of turning, facing, and drilling jobs. Excess metal is removed by rotating the work piece over the fixed cutting tool to form straight or tapered cylindrical shapes, grooves, shoulders and screw threads. It can also be used for facing flat surfaces on the ends of cylindrical parts.

The work piece is clamped onto a horizontal rotating shaft by a 3-jaw or 4-jaw chuck. The latter chuck can be used to cut off-centered cylinders. The rotating horizontal spindle to which the chuck is attached is usually driven at speeds that can be varied.

The cutting tool is fixed onto a tool rest and manipulated by hand. It can also be power driven on straight paths parallel or perpendicular to the work axis. This is useful for screw cutting.

Internal turning known as boring results in the enlargement of an already existing hole. The holes are more accurate in roundness, concentricity, and parallelism than drilled holes. A hole is bored with a single-point-cutting tool that feeds along the inside of the work piece.

Shaping Machine

The shaping machine is used to machine flat surfaces, grooves, shoulders, T-slots, and angular surfaces with single-point tools. The cutting tool on the shaper oscillates, cutting on the forward stroke, with the work piece feeding automatically toward the tool during each return stroke.

Drilling Machine

The drilling machine is used to cut holes in metal with a twist drill. By changing the cutting tool, they can be used to do reaming, boring, counter boring, countersinking, and threading.

Milling Machine

The milling machine uses a rotating cutting tool to cut flat surfaces, grooves, and shoulders, inclined surfaces, dovetails, and T-slots. Cutters of many shapes are changed to cut different grooves.

Cutting Tools

Metal-cutting tools are classified as single point or multiple point. The lathe and shaping machine use single point cutting tool while the milling and drilling machines use multiple-point-cutting tools.

Metal is cut either by moving the work piece like in the lathe or by moving the tool like in the shaping machine, drilling or milling machine. Clearance angles must be provided to prevent the tool surface below the cutting edge from rubbing against the work piece. Rake angles are often provided on cutting tools to cause a wedging action in the formation of chips and to reduce friction and heat.

Tool Materials

In order to remove chips from a work piece, a cutting tool must be harder than the work piece and must maintain a cutting edge at the temperature produced by the friction of the cutting action.

Carbon Steel

Carbon steel tools even though comparatively inexpensive tend to lose cutting ability at temperatures around 400 degree F (205 degree C).

High-Speed Steel

High-speed steel, containing 18 percent tungsten, 4 percent chromium, 1 percent vanadium, and only 0.5 to 0.8 percent carbon, permits the operation of tools twice or three times the speeds allowable with carbon steel

Cast Alloys

Cast-alloy cutting-tool materials containing cobalt, chromium, and tungsten are effective in cutting cast iron and retaining their cutting ability even when red hot.

Cemented Tungsten Carbide

The hardness of Tungsten Carbide approaches that of a diamond. Tungsten carbide tools can be operated at cutting speeds many times higher than those used with high-speed steel.

Oxides

Ceramic, or oxide, tool tips consist primarily of fine aluminum oxide grains, which are bonded together. These are very hard.

Cutting fluids

An overheated tool can become blunt and soft very fast. Therefore very often, cooling fluids cools the cutting points of the tool. This serves to lubricate and cool.

Water is an excellent cooling medium, but it corrodes ferrous materials. Sulfurized mineral oil is one of the most popular coolants as it can both cool as well as lubricate. The sulfur prevents chips from the work from melting on to the tip of the tool.

 

Cordless Tools - Who's Who In Super Tools

The cordless drill is an electric tool that runs on rechargeable batteries. It doesn't need any electrical power outlet or extension cord to do its job, as long as the battery has charge in it. This makes it very mobile, capable of working in almost any situations. Carpenters, electricians, and handymen all love this tool. Its popularity quickly spawns many other cordless tools that are similar, but more specialized. Here's a list of some of them.

1. Cordless Drills

This is a rotary tool that can either drill holes or drive fasteners, depending on the bit attachment it uses. It's also referred to as a cordless drill driver. They vary in sizes and power capacities. The power of brushless angle grinder this tools usually goes by its voltage rating. It can be a compact model at 7-volt, or a super-hefty model at 36-volt. The higher the voltage, the more rotational torque power it can produce, and it will be bulkier and heavier, too. Depending on what type of work on hand, choosing the right power-rating can be the difference between an easy job or tough going.

2. Hammer Drills.

This tool has a hammering mechanism that can produce hammering impacts while it turns. This hammering mechanism is engaged when a switch or dial is set to the ON position. When the hammering mechanism is disengaged, it works exactly like a regular cordless drill.

The hammering action is important when working on brick, or rock, or other kinds of masonry. It's chipping away as well as scraping away the material. You will need to use a masonry bit because a regular twist bit gets dull quickly in the masonry material. This tool is slightly more expensive than the regular tool, but the hammering option is highly worthy of the price.

If you have decided that a cordless drill would be an asset to your tool collection in your new workshop shed (if you have decided on a metal storage shed this will be particularly handy) there are a few considerations to take into account.

Cordless drills are quite popular and there is a significant variety to choose from. Weight can become an issue with cordless drills because of the weight of the battery pack. When choosing the tool of your choice it is a good idea to assess the grip style. It should fit comfortably in your grasp. Make sure the switch and lock are easily accessed for safety and accuracy.

Higher voltage is needed for heavier drilling so take that into account when deciding. Most range from two to twenty four volts. It is better to purchase a drill with more power than you anticipate needing and you will never find yourself in a bind with too little power available.

Two speed gear selection with variable speed in each selection will provide options for drilling in different materials. For instance drilling into hardwood requires slower speed and more torque than drilling into soft wood which requires higher speeds. With some drills the speed will adjust automatically with type and density of the material being used. Also take into account the type of cordless oscillating tool chuck supplied with the tool. It can be either tightened with a key or finger tightened.

Batteries are obviously very important since this is what will drive the drill. How long will the battery hold a single charge? How long does it take to charge the battery when the charge runs down? Does the drill come with two batteries? You might want to look for a model that has a lithium-ion battery. These batteries are 25 percent lighter than NiCad or NiMH batteries which you will generally find powering battery operated tools. The lithium-ion battery also has more capacity which translates into longer run time per charge and these types of batteries can handle hundreds of charge/discharge cycles.
